Log message:
Add boot.conf(8) 'mach idle [secs]' to halt at idle passphrase prompts

Enable users to power down their machines if there was no input after N
seconds during disk descryption.

Motivation is to save battery and prevent pocket heaters when notebooks
unhibernate (e.g. lid accidentially opened) and sit at "Passphrase: ".

Only available on efi(4) systems as the timeout is saved as EFI variable;
mostly because that's trivial to do, but also because we lack a better
mechanism to configure that and persist such data without the root disk.
